São Paulo hosted a major conference bringing together experts in mental health and employment to discuss the challenges faced by workers and strategies to improve mental health support in the workplace. The event, which is currently ongoing, underscores the rising concern over mental health issues among workers and the need for integrated approaches to address them.

The conference, organized by local health authorities and professional associations, features specialists from various fields including psychology, psychiatry, occupational health, and human resources. Participants are exchanging insights on the impact of work-related stress, burnout, and anxiety, which have seen increased attention amid the broader mental health crisis.

According to organizers, the event aims to foster dialogue on policies and practices that can promote mental well-being at work. It also seeks to identify best practices for employers to support employees facing mental health challenges, with a focus on preventative measures and early intervention.

While specific speakers or agenda items have not been publicly detailed, the gathering reflects a growing trend across Brazil and globally, where mental health in the workplace is gaining prominence as a critical issue.

Rising Attention to Workplace Mental Health in Brazil

Over recent years, mental health concerns have gained significant attention in Brazil, driven by rising reports of anxiety, depression, and burnout among workers. The COVID-19 pandemic intensified these issues, prompting calls for more structured support in workplaces. Previous initiatives have included public campaigns and policy discussions, but comprehensive strategies remain under development.

The gathering in São Paulo is part of a broader trend of increasing focus on mental health, both nationally and internationally. Experts have emphasized that addressing mental health in work environments is crucial for improving overall worker well-being and economic productivity. However, details on specific policies or commitments resulting from this event are still emerging.
